Hiya! Sorry to hear about this curveball life has thrown you..
I compile CD's for a living, would you believe, for background music for restaurants etc. I did a CD last summer for a bar who wanted positive, "outdoors in the sun with a cold beer" music. Here's what was on it, may be a few good ones for you: 1. Boo Radleys - Wake Up Boo 2. Dodgy - Good Enough 3. Bill Withers - Lovely Day 4. Commodores - Easy 5. Johnny Nash - I Can See Clearly Now 6. Finley Quaye - Even After All 7. U2 - Beautiful Day 8. Stereophonics - Have A Nice Day 9. Sundays - Summertime 10. Zoe - Sunshine On A Rainy Day 11. Katrina & Waves - Walking On Sunshine 12. Bob Marley - Sun Is Shining 13. Shanice - I Love Your Smile 14. KC & Sunshine Band - That's The Way I Like It 15. Sheryl Crow - All I Wanna Do 16. Bobby McFerrin - Don't Worry Be Happy Plus there's things like Let's Face The Music And Dance (Nat King Cole) Moving On Up - M People ("nothing can stop me") I Will Survive - maybe a little too literal, but a very strong, personal "you can do anything you wanna do, don't let anything stpo you" kinda song. Paid My Dues - Anastacia (and a good role model too, she beat cancer to come back fighting) Good lyrics like "you can't stop me now". James Brown - I Feel Good | |
